Client and Server CMIS connector for Microsoft SharePoint Server 2010
Posted by Nico in .NET, CMIS Clients, CMIS Server on 14. August 2010
Microsoft just announced their CMIS connector for Microsoft SharePoint Server 2010, which enables SharePoint users to interact with content that is stored in any repository that has implemented the CMIS standard. The connector also makes SharePoint Server 2010 content available to any application that has implemented the CMIS standard. The CMIS connector is available as part of the SharePoint 2010 Administration Toolkit.
So this means that the SharePoint Server 2010 now has the functionality to act as as CMIS client and as a CMIS server.

Microsoft SharePoint will support CMIS in June 2010 – CMIS Connector for SharePoint
Posted by Nico in .NET, CMIS Clients, CMIS Server on 22. April 2010
Ryan Duguid, Senior Product Manager at Microsoft Corporation just posted in the msdn blog that Microsoft will support CMIS by the End of June 2010. They will ship the CMIS Connector for SharePoint as part of the SharePoint Administrator Toolkit.
The CMIS Connector for SharePoint provides a CMIS (Content Management Interoperability Services)interface over the top of SharePoint as well as a CMIS consumer Web Part that can be used to display content from other CMIS enabled repositories.

Alfresco Community 3.3 fully supports CMIS 1.0
Posted by Nico in CMIS Server, DMS, General, JAVA on 11. April 2010
Beside some other interesting enhancements the new Alfresco Community version 3.3 will have full CMIS 1.0 support.
This includes:
- CMIS Query
- Web Services Binding
- REST Binding
- Access Control Lists
- Change Logs
- Renditions
- CMIS Test Compatibility Kit
- Plus Alfresco extension for Aspect query and property get/set operations

The AIIM iECM CMIS Demo 2009
Posted by Nico in CMIS Server, DMS on 28. January 2010
Thomas Pole and Laurence Hart wrote a document about the AIIM iECM CMIS Demo 2009 (iECM is the abbreviation for AIIM’s Interoperable ECM).
Within this document they explain how the CMIS demo was planned and accomplished. The concept was to create a federated search interface that would allow users to search multiple repositories from a single search screen. Several vendors showed interest in assisting the iECM committee and participated on the initial planning calls. At the End Nuxeo, EMC and Alfresco commited themselves to participate to make their repositories CMIS mostly compliant for this demo. This demo has been presented at the AIIM Expo 2009. IBM FileNet and IBM Content Manager Technology Preview for CMIS
Posted by Nico in CMIS Server, DMS on 17. December 2009
IBM offers a technical preview for there CMIS implementation that provides support for the CMIS REST/Atom binding for the IBM® FileNet® and IBM Content Manager repositories.
The preview provides a servlet (CMIS web application) packaged as a WAR (Web Application Archive) file that can be deployed in WebSphere®, to support REST services expressed in the CMIS specification. The CMIS web application translates these services at run time to Java™ API calls to the IBM FileNet and IBM Content Manager repositories. The preview uses the IBM FileNet and IBM Content Manager Java APIs to access the native repository.

CMIS4SharePoint – CMIS Implementation for WSS 3.0 and MOSS 2007
Posted by Nico in .NET, CMIS Server, DMS on 7. December 2009
Since a few days there is the first open source implementation of CMIS standards for SharePoint Platform WSS 3.0 and MOSS 2007 available. It’s called CMIS4SharePoint.
At the moment the implementation is in accordance with the draft version 0.5 of the standard. It covers the web-service part and aims to be a complete implementation of CMIS v1.0 with the help of the community.
At the moment the project is in the alpha status.
The source code is hosted at the following website: http://cmis4sharepoint.codeplex.com.
CMIS v0.61 is now supported by Alfresco Community Edition 3.2
Posted by Nico in CMIS Server on 7. July 2009
The Alfresco Community Edition 3.2 is now released.
Beside different enhancements it now supports CMIS v0.61.
- All mandatory CMIS v0.61 capabilities and most of the optional
- Web Services and AtomPub (REST) Bindings support includes:
- Create/Read/Update/Delete
- Types including custom metadata
- Versioning
- Relationships
- Allowable actions
- Query (with the exception of Joins)
